强酸性阳离子交换树脂催化合成乙酸脱氢芳樟酯

摘要:采用强酸性阳离子交换树脂为催化剂,以脱氢芳樟醇和乙酸酐为原料合成乙酸脱氢芳樟酯,考察了离子交换树脂的处理方法、催化剂用量以及反应条件等因素对反应结果的影响。当n(脱氢芳樟醇):n(乙酸酐)=1:1.2、反应温度80℃、催化剂用量为醇酐总质量的5%、反应时间为3.5h时,反应的转化率和选择性分别达到80%和90%以上。
Dehydrolinalinalyl acetate was synthesized from dehydrolinalool and acetic anhydride by direct esterification using strong acid cation-exchange resin as a catalyst. The influence of reaction conditions, dosage of catalyst and the handling of catalyst were discussed. Under proper synthesis conditions as follow: the molar ratio of alcohol to anhydride was 1:1.2, reaction temperature was 80 ℃, reaction time was 3.5 h and catalyst loading was 5%, the reaction conversion and the selectivity was higher than 80% and 90%, respectively.
